Kerosene poisoning--varied systemic manifestations.
Article in English | IMSEAR | ID: sea-86227
ABSTRACT
We report here unusual clinical manifestations in a case of kerosene poisoning. The patient presented with encephalopathy and in the course of stay in the hospital developed renal tubular acidosis, delayed first-degree burns and myocarditis. With supportivetherapy the patient recovered completely and was discharged without any sequelae.
